Adebutu Advocates Youth Investment to Combat Unemployment

Adebutu Advocates Youth Investment to Combat Unemployment

Ladi Adebutu, the 2027 Ogun State governorship cand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party, advocated for increased investment in vocational training, entrepreneurship, and affordable financing for young Nigerians to address unemployment and stimulate economic growth. Speaking at the 5th Agbaletu Progressive Movement anniversary on Tuesday at the Olusegun Obasanjo Presidential Library in Abeokuta, Adebutu highlighted that about 100 young people were empowered through vocational training and educational support during the event.

He stressed the necessity for government, individuals, and philanthropic organizations to provide practical skills, mentorship, and access to capital for young people. Adebutu stated that affordable capital is crucial for young entrepreneurs and small business owners to establish and sustain their businesses.

He emphasized that creating an environment conducive to business growth is essential for economic development and job creation. Mrs. Adenike Adebutu, the Life Matron of the Agbaletu Progressive Movement, urged parents to encourage their children to acquire vocational skills alongside formal education, arguing that practical skills are vital for self-reliance in the current economic climate.
